Core Topics in Math for 6th Graders

Sixth grade math covers a wide range of topics, each designed to enhance numerical fluency and analytical thinking. Let’s explore some of the most important areas that students focus on during this year.

Fractions, Decimals, and Percentages

Understanding the relationship between fractions, decimals, and percentages is a key skill in 6th grade math. Students learn how to convert between these forms and apply them in real-world contexts, such as calculating discounts, interest rates, or proportions. For example, a student might be asked to find what 25% of a number is or convert 0.75 into a fraction. These exercises improve number sense and help students see the interconnectedness of different mathematical representations.

Ratios and Proportional Relationships

Ratios and proportions are often new concepts for many students entering 6th grade. These topics teach how two quantities relate to each other and how to solve problems involving scaling up or down. Practical applications, like mixing ingredients in a recipe or comparing speeds, make these ideas tangible. Mastery of ratios also sets the stage for understanding rates and rates of change later on.

Introduction to Algebraic Thinking

Math for 6th graders introduces simple algebraic expressions and equations. This might include understanding variables, writing expressions, and solving one-step equations. This early exposure demystifies algebra and encourages logical reasoning. For example, a student might solve for x in an equation like x + 5 = 12, which strengthens their ability to manipulate and understand mathematical symbols.

Geometry and Measurement

Geometry topics become more detailed in 6th grade, including the study of area, volume, and surface area. Students also learn about different types of angles, triangles, and polygons. Measurement skills are enhanced by working with both customary and metric units, and applying formulas to calculate dimensions of various shapes. This hands-on approach helps students visualize math concepts and understand their practical uses.

Data Analysis and Probability

Analyzing data and understanding probability are introduced in a way that encourages curiosity and interpretation. Students learn to read graphs, calculate mean, median, mode, and range, and explore simple probability scenarios. These skills are important for developing critical thinking and making informed decisions based on data, a vital competency in today’s data-driven world.

Effective Strategies for Teaching and Learning Math for 6th Graders

Math can sometimes feel intimidating, but with the right strategies, 6th graders can develop a positive relationship with the subject. Here are some tips to make learning math more engaging and effective.

Use Real-Life Examples

Connecting math concepts to everyday situations helps students understand why what they’re learning matters. Whether it’s calculating the cost of items while shopping or measuring ingredients for a recipe, real-life examples make abstract ideas concrete.

Encourage Hands-On Learning

Manipulatives like fraction tiles, geometric shapes, and graphing tools can enhance comprehension. Visual and tactile experiences often help students grasp complex concepts better than just reading from a textbook.

Incorporate Technology

There are numerous educational apps and online platforms designed specifically for math for 6th graders. Interactive games and tutorials can provide immediate feedback and make practice more enjoyable.

Foster Problem-Solving Skills

Encourage students to approach problems methodically—understanding the problem, devising a plan, carrying it out, and reviewing the solution. This process nurtures deeper understanding and resilience.

Build on Prior Knowledge

Since 6th grade math builds on earlier skills, ensuring that students have a solid grasp of basic arithmetic is crucial. Reviewing addition, subtraction, multiplication, and division fluently can prevent gaps in understanding.

Common Challenges and How to Overcome Them

Despite best efforts, some students may struggle with certain aspects of math for 6th graders. Recognizing these hurdles early can lead to effective interventions. One frequent challenge is transitioning from concrete arithmetic to abstract reasoning. Students who excelled at memorizing facts might find it difficult to apply concepts to new problems. To support these learners, it’s helpful to break problems down into smaller steps and use visual aids. Another issue is difficulty with fractions and decimals, which can be confusing due to the multiple representations and operations involved. Providing plenty of practice with different types of problems, along with hands-on activities, can improve confidence. Time management during tests or homework is also a common hurdle. Teaching students how to pace themselves and prioritize problems can alleviate anxiety and improve performance.

What is the greatest common divisor (GCD) and how do you find it?

+

The greatest common divisor (GCD) of two numbers is the largest number that divides both of them without leaving a remainder. To find the GCD, list the factors of both numbers and choose the greatest one they have in common.

How do you convert a fraction to a decimal?

+

To convert a fraction to a decimal, divide the numerator (top number) by the denominator (bottom number) using long division or a calculator.

What is the difference between mean, median, and mode?

+

Mean is the average of a set of numbers, found by adding all numbers and dividing by the count. Median is the middle number when the numbers are arranged in order. Mode is the number that appears most frequently in the set.

How do you solve a simple equation like 3x + 5 = 20?

+

To solve 3x + 5 = 20, first subtract 5 from both sides to get 3x = 15. Then divide both sides by 3 to find x = 5.

What are prime numbers and how can you identify them?

+

Prime numbers are numbers greater than 1 that have only two factors: 1 and themselves. To identify a prime number, check if it can be divided evenly only by 1 and itself.

How do you calculate the area of a triangle?

+

The area of a triangle is calculated using the formula: Area = 1/2 × base × height, where the base is the length of the bottom side and the height is the perpendicular distance from the base to the opposite vertex.
